I went to see my oncologist the other day. Very well-respected doctor at Northwestern Medicine. I have been sending her info on the COC protocol and we finally sat down to discuss. She. Was. Awesome. Not in the least condescending or off-putting. In fact, she had the COC-requested records faxed before I even left her office. She also contacted the Northwestern Oncology Pharmacy to make sure the drugs wouldn’t negatively react.
